Zipper

A zipper is a fastening device used to securely close and open items like clothing, bags, or tents. It consists of two rows of small metal or plastic teeth that interlock when the slider is pulled down or up. The slider moves along the teeth, guiding them to engage or disengage, effectively closing or opening the item. Zippers are convenient, durable, and quickly provide a secure closure, making them a common choice for garments, luggage, and other items requiring a reliable opening and closing mechanism.
